      It's already in 3.2 I believe. I've at least enabled it in my 3.2 kernel, and haven't seen any error messages regarding it. Michael says (in this article)

      Taking full advantage of PCI Express 2.0 for Radeon graphics cards involves setting a few registers related to the PCI-E link width and speed control. The code has been there for the supported generations of Radeon hardware for many months now, but it is not on by default. Like the Intel RC6 and Active State Power Management problems in the Linux kernel, PCI-E Gen2 is not on by default at this time due to a few hardware-specific problems. For some problematic systems, having the Radeon DRM with PCI Express 2.0 support enabled will cause a corrupted screen upon mode-setting. The problem comes down to compatibility issues with some motherboards. For over a year now the PCI-E Gen2 support has been concealed behind a kernel module parameter.

      Those wishing to take advantage of PCI Express 2.0 with supported motherboards (nearly all Intel and AMD motherboards from 2008 and newer) and graphics cards (Radeon HD 3000 series and newer) must boot the kernel with the "radeon.pcie_gen2=1" on the kernel command line (or probe the radeon DRM with "pcie_gen2=1"), otherwise the graphics card will still be operating at PCI Express 1.0 speeds. Even with the forthcoming Linux 3.3 kernel, PCI-E 2.0 support is still off by default with the Radeon driver.

          I've tested a few application but only from one I have some numbers

          With nexuiz I've done a timedemo and the results are

          without PCI-E 2.0: 23 / 37 / 83
          with PCI-E 2.0: 33 / 49 / 119

          so in average it is ~ 33% faster.
          And since I haven't seen any disadvantages yet, I'll keep it that way for now.
